Attorneys for Asbestos Exposure

From the 1930s until the 1970s, asbestos was extensively used in construction materials. It was used in insulation for pipes, fireproofing products, plasters and cements, car brakes and many more. The exposure to this dangerous mineral can trigger a number of serious medical conditions, including mesothelioma as well as other respiratory illnesses.

Asbest fibers are inhaled when they are extracted and processed. This can cause lung cancer, asbestosis and mesothelioma. People who handle asbestos directly are more at risk, but anyone can inhale asbestos. This type of exposure, also known as secondary exposure is a risk to anyone who comes in contact with the worker's contaminated clothes or equipment. This includes relatives who wash the uniform of the worker as well as anyone living in the same house. This is often the case on ships and bases of military in which workers wear the identical uniform for a long time.

People in construction, insulation, shipyards, milling, mining and other occupations could be exposed to asbestos. This was especially the case in the United States between the 1950s and 1990s. Workers were exposed to asbestos when the old buildings were remodeled or demolished as well as when building materials were damaged. materials. Even these days, the demolition and remodeling in older buildings could release asbestos into the atmosphere.

It can be a long period of time between exposure to asbestos and beginning of mesothelioma or other symptoms. It is therefore essential to see a doctor in the event that you have been exposed to asbestos, or suspect that you are suffering from any of the illnesses related to asbestos claim.

Your doctor will examine your lungs, and ask about any asbestos-related history of work. If they suspect you have an asbestos-related condition they'll likely recommend you to a specialist for additional tests. Chest X-rays CT scans, and pulmonary function tests can all detect asbestos-related illnesses, but they don't always appear on these tests.

These diseases can appear in the lungs, abdomen (abdomen) and heart. It is not common for mesothelioma to develops in the brain.

Claim Your Claim

Your attorney will gather your health records and employment records to create a timeline for your asbestos exposure. Then, they'll build your case by assembling evidence to prove that you were exposed and that your exposure caused harm. They will then send each defendant a copy of your complaint and they will be given 30 days to respond. Defendants typically deny liability and they may try to pin blame on another person. You need an experienced team of lawyers to tackle these denials.

Once they have all the required documents, your attorney will submit your asbestos lawsuit. They will file it in the state court system that best fits your case. During this time, the attorneys will gather evidence and conduct discovery where they share information with the opposing party regarding the case. If a trial is requested and they are required to represent you in the trial. However, the majority of cases are resolved through an asbestos settlement.

It is crucial to hire a mesothelioma expert because asbestos litigation is distinct from other personal injury claims. They have access to a database which shows patients which asbestos products they worked with on the job. This allows patients to identify the products that were the cause of their exposure.

In addition, they'll be aware of the types of companies that are accountable for your exposure, such as the manufacturers of the asbestos-containing products you handled, and even the owners of buildings containing asbestos. They can also file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ds if you were exposed to more than one company's asbestos-contaminated products.
